INDICATIONS ON PERIODIC CHECKS

After the components' first fitting and break-in (generally after the first 100-
250 km), use a torque wrench to check the correct tightening of all the bolts. If
needed, loose the bolts and re-tighten to the correct torque.
WARNING: Bolts that are too tight or too loose can cause serious accidents that
can lead to serious injuries or death.
WARNING: Deda Elementi stems are designed to operate properly within a
tightening range of 4 to 5 Nm! If you must exceed these values in order to avoid
relative rotation of fork steerer, stem and handlebar, please contact your DEDA
ELEMENTI dealer or contact us at info@dedaelementi.com
Please repeat this check at least every 1500 km.
All bicycle components are subjected to wear, properties and performance
deterioration, based on your bicycle care and maintenance and on the
environmental conditions to which the bike is exposed, e.g. rain, mud, dust
and sand, saline environments, etc. Metal parts are particularly sensitive to
atmospheric corrosion combined with the effect of athlete's sweating.
WARNING: Accidents, bumps or falls can produce micro cracks in metal
components that are not apparently visible and give rise to sudden failures
and breakages over time. These can cause serious accidents that can lead to
serious injuries or death. Deda Elementi stems and faceplates are made of hard
aluminium alloy. If are damaged as a result of impact or bicycle fall, they cannot
be repaired. They MUST be replaced.
Every two years, or every year in the case of intensive use, please have a qualified
Deda Elementi mechanic inspect the stem for integrity.
